A new achievement added to the record of excellence at the Faculty of Engineering at Shoubra – Benha University!

Under the patronage of Professor Dr. Nasser El-Gizawy, President of Benha University, and with his continuous support for graduation projects and the encouragement of innovation among students, Professor Dr. Mohamed Said Abdel-Ghaffar, Dean of the Faculty of Engineering at Shoubra, extends his sincere congratulations to our students for the success of six (6) outstanding projects in the "Egypt Makes" competition. This achievement reaffirms that Benha University students are the pillars of innovation and the future of Egypt.

Heartfelt congratulations to the winning teams and their esteemed supervisors who provided unwavering support throughout this journey:

Qualified Projects:

  1. Project: Quad-Path Robotics (Robotic System for Automated Inventory Control)

    • Supervised by: Assoc. Prof. Dr. Mahmoud Mohamed El-Samanty

  2. Project: Robox (Design of a Five-Degree-of-Freedom Product Distribution Robot)

    • Supervised by: Assoc. Prof. Dr. Mahmoud Mohamed El-Samanty

  3. Project: Autopharma (Smart Automated Pharmacy Dispensing System)

    • Supervised by: Dr. Mohamed Gamil

  4. Project: Fault Diagnosis (Fault Diagnosis in Rotating Machinery using Vibration Analysis)

    • Supervised by: Dr. Mohamed Gamil

  5. Project: RoboRash (Automated Precision Excellence Execution Painting Robot Arm)

    • Supervised by: Dr. Mohamed Saber Sakr

  6. Project: Hayah

    • Supervised by: Assoc. Prof. Dr. Aya Hossam El-Din Mahmoud & Dr. Ahmed Samir

All respect to our creative students who have raised the Faculty's name high. We wish them continued success in the upcoming stages as they work toward turning these ideas into a reality that serves the Egyptian industry.
